免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发价格如何

随着智能手机的普及,移动应用程序(简称app)已经成为一个非常热门的市场,每个人都想尝试创建自己的应用程序。但是,很多人并不知道app开发的成本。因此,在这篇文章中,我将介绍一些影响app开发成本的因素并解释开发费用如何计算。

1. 设计

设计是app开发的第一步。在设计阶段,需要制定一个详细的计划,即app的设计方案。这个计划需要包括UI设计(用户界面)、UX设计(用户体验)以及交互设计。设计的质量是影响开发成本的主要因素之一。高质量的设计需要更多的时间和劳动力,并且相应地增加了成本。

2. 开发平台

开发平台也是影响app开发费用的主要因素之一。移动应用通常基于Android和iOS操作系统平台进行开发。如果想要开发一款app,需要对两种平台的编程语言和接口有所了解。因此,开发两种平台的app会翻倍由于需要更多的工作量。

3. 功能

另一个影响app开发成本的关键因素是应用程序的功能。它包括应用程序的核心功能,例如音频播放器、视频播放器、社交网络功能、数据收集和数据处理等和更高级的功能,包括AR(增强现实)和VR(虚拟现实)功能。较为复杂的功能需要更多编码时间和技术工作,导致更高的成本。

4. API集成

API可用于连接不同的应用程序和服务,使他们之间的数据交换更加灵活。这些API有时需要额外付费或订阅才能使用。开发人员使用API集成可以使app更加有用,并使它们更容易与其他应用程序进行通信。

5. 测试

为了确保应用程序质量,需要进行广泛的测试。测试工作包括验收测试(确保应用程序符合要求)以及性能测试(确保应用程序在各种不同的条件下运行)。

6. 维护

维护和支持应用程序还是成本之一。一旦应用程序发布,需要定期维护和更新来确保应用程序良好运作。这包括为新的系统更新编写代码,修复代码漏洞,处理应用程序崩溃等。

尽管所有的app都不相同,但总体来说,一些基本的成本计算技巧适用于几乎所有的app开发项目。其中包括:

1. 了解市场上的价格和竞争

市场上的价格和竞争程度不断变化。因此,在估计成本时,必须时刻注意市场和竞争。也可以进行一些市场研究,以确定你想要的功能是否可以实现,并了解目标受众和类似应用程序的价格和功能。

2. 制定一个详细的计划

制定一个详细的计划可以帮助你更好地安排时间并确保项目不会偏离。这还可以为开发人员提供一些基础性的信息,例如需要开发的平台、功能和应用程序设计。

总体而言,app开发的价格主要取决于项目的规模和复杂程度,以及所用的技术和工具。一个简单的应用程序只需要几千美元,而一个更复杂的应用程序可能需要数十万美元。因此,在开始app开发之前,请尽可能详细地了解app开发的成本和影响因素


相关知识:
浅谈社交app开发的前景
随着智能手机和移动互联网的普及,社交app已经成为了人们生活中必不可少的一部分。从最早的微信、QQ、微博,到现在的抖音、快手、小红书,社交app已经成为了人们日常生活中不可或缺的一部分。因此,社交app开发的前景非常广阔,下面我将从原理和详细介绍两个方面来
2024-01-10
山东批发商城app开发定制
随着移动互联网的普及,越来越多的企业开始意识到移动应用的重要性。作为一个批发商城,如果没有一款自己的移动应用,就会失去与时俱进的竞争力。因此,山东批发商城也需要开发一款自己的移动应用来提升自己的市场竞争力。一、需求分析在开发一款移动应用之前,首先需要进行需
2024-01-10
js开发app结构图
JS开发App的结构图主要由以下几个部分组成:1. 前端界面:前端界面是App的用户界面,包括各种UI元素、按钮、图标等。前端界面一般使用HTML、CSS和JavaScript来实现,可以通过前端框架(如React、Vue等)来快速构建界面。2. 逻辑处理
2023-07-14
app开发七天
APP开发是指通过编程语言和开发工具,将想法和设计转化为可以在移动设备上运行的应用程序。在这篇文章中,我将介绍APP开发的基本原理和详细步骤,帮助读者快速入门。第一天:准备工作在开始APP开发之前,我们需要准备一些工具和资源。首先,我们需要一台电脑和一个操
2023-06-29
app开发路线图
移动应用程序(App)已成为现代社会的必需品,而这也使得App开发成为了一个高度需求的职业。如果您对App开发感兴趣并想要入门或提升相关知识,那么下面是一个App开发路线图以供参考。1. 学习编程基础知识在学习开发App之前,建议先学习一门编程语言,比如说
2023-06-29
app开发 ide
APP开发IDE(Integrated Development Environment,集成开发环境),是一款软件开发工具,帮助开发者编写、调试和测试应用程序。它是一种将多种开发工具集成在一起的应用程序,包括代码编辑器、调试器、编译器、版本控制系统、图形用
2023-05-06